There are a few important things to keep in mind if you want to become a successful interior designer. First, it is important to have a firm understanding of the basic principles of design. This includes understanding proportion, balance, scale, color theory, and so forth. Second, it is crucial to be able to visualize concepts and see how they would work in various spaces. This requires both creative imagination and technical drawing skills. thirdly, Interior designers need to be good communicators and be able to effectively manage client relationships. Lastly, because the field of interior design is continually evolving, it is important to stay up-to-date on new trends and developments.

There are a few things to keep in mind if you're interested in becoming an interior designer. First, it's important to have a good eye for detail and aesthetics. You should be able to spot potential design problems and have an idea of how to fix them. Secondly, you need to be competent in planning and measuring spaces; this will come in handy when estimating budgets and designating certain areas for specific purposes. Thirdly, effective communication is critical in this field – you'll need to be able to articulate your vision clearly to clients, contractors, and other professionals. Finally, it's helpful to be up-to-date on the latest industry trends so that you can incorporate them into your designs.

Hello! If you're interested in becoming an interior designer, here are a few tips and pieces of advice that might be helpful to you:
First and foremost, it's important to develop a strong sense of aesthetics. Be able to identify what you think looks good, and why certain design choices work well together. It's also important to have a good understanding of different design styles - so you can create designs that are tailored to your client's taste.
In terms of hard skills, it's important to be proficient in CAD software (like AutoCAD or SketchUp), as well as 3D rendering software (like 3ds Max or Rhino).

There are a few things you can do to become a successful interior designer:
First and foremost, develop your creative eye. This means having a good sense of composition, color, and style. You need to be able to visualize how a space can be transformed and know what elements will work well together.
Secondly, brush up on your technical skills. You’ll need to know how to use design software like AutoCAD or 3D Studio Max, as well as have a good understanding of building codes and regulations.
If you can combine both your creative vision with strong technical abilities, you’ll be ahead of the pack.
And thirdly, remember that client satisfaction is key.
